Output e1406fb15557213ca45a4bb403f1287c79e8976e69d804bfcc1fc87eda3e7de7:0

value
24407539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 934e14127cd74459ab369185604cca64ee5ed53d OP_EQUAL
address
3F7tnj3N4gZfTujDfDhgQvhEZyFQXb6CSP
transaction
e1406fb15557213ca45a4bb403f1287c79e8976e69d804bfcc1fc87eda3e7de7
confirmations
393876
spent
true